About the role
This is a unique and rewarding role combining classroom teaching, nurture provision, and outreach work, offering the chance to influence not only our pupils but also practice across our wider community.
About the Role
You will:
- Lead a small, supportive nurture environment for pupils with SEMH needs
- Deliver personalised, engaging learning experiences
- Support children’s emotional development alongside academic progress
- Work closely with our existing onsite team and outreach provision, supporting children and their families
- Be part of a highly skilled, compassionate, and collaborative team
We Are Looking For Someone Who:
- Is a qualified teacher with a passion for SEMH and inclusion
- Holds the recognised nurture qualification and has experience of leading nurture groups
- Understands trauma-informed and nurture-based approaches
- Builds strong, trusting relationships with children and families
- Is calm, flexible, and solution-focused
- Can work effectively across both school and outreach settings
What We Offer:
- A supportive and forward-thinking leadership team
- Ongoing professional development in SEMH and nurture approaches
- Opportunities to work across both specialist and outreach provision
- A highly rewarding role where you can make a lasting impact
The successful applicants will receive bespoke training (depending on experience) to develop knowledge, skill sets, understanding and effectiveness. This ensures that we offer the best educational and pastoral support for our primary age students.
